We wrote that the Pentagon will request $179 million forLockheed Martin for the production of an additional 28 M142 highly mobile artillery missile systems. In addition to HIMARS, a large number of other military equipment is expected to be purchased, but the amounts are not specified:
- 91 armored personnel carriers to replace the M113 for the US Army (BAE Systems);
- 48 fifth-generation F-35 fighters for the US Air Force (Lockheed Martin);
- 42 AH-64E Apache helicopters (Boeing);
- 33 light tanks (General Dynamics);
- 24 modernized F-15EX Eagle II fighters (Boeing);
- 15 air tankers KC-46 Pegasus (Boeing);
- 8 hypersonic missiles for the US Navy (Lockheed Martin);
- 7 NH-139A Gray Wolf helicopters to protect mines with nuclear weapons (Boeing);
- 2 Constellation-class frigates (Fincantieri / Marinette Marine of Marinette);
- 2 Virginia class submarines (General Dynamics and HII);
- 2 Arleigh Burke-class destroyers (General Dynamics and HII).
In addition to this, the US Department of Defensewill request funds to improve 34 General Dynamics Abrams M1A2 tanks. In addition, the application includes a budget to finance 10 space missions.
